#61fe77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61fe77 is composed of 38% red, 99.6%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 128.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 68.8%. #61fe77 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ffee with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#61fe77 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61fe77 has RGB values of R:97, G:254,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0. Its decimal value is 6422135.

Shades and Tints of #61fe77
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001103 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.
